Arrived back at home from Nepal safe and sound Monday-Nepal is a beautiful country and the people are amazing, unfortunately the infrastructure is in a state of collapse- 6 hours of electricity per day with no set time as to when the power is on or off, daily life is hard- 80% of the population live on less than a dollar a day- The Maoist government coupled with the negative effects of global warming [no rain for months]are facing a massive challenge to get the country running on an even keel, tensions are high and there is a large police,national army/ maoist army presence in the streets, rebel factions are constantly kidnapping, shooting and looting in the Terai regions. Throw in an outbreak of bird flu on the India/Nepalese borders... plus the recent murder of a number of journalists.... and the fear that Tibeten refugees may be in for a very very hard time soon.....
